Overview Oxo 400mg Tablet

This antibiotic, Oxo 400mg Tablet, combats bacterial infections affecting various parts of the body, including the urinary tract, respiratory system (pneumonia), and skin. Its mechanism involves halting bacterial proliferation, thus resolving the infection. Dosage and treatment length should strictly follow your physician's instructions. Administer with or without food, consistently at the same time each day. Complete the prescribed course, even with symptom improvement, avoiding missed doses. Minor side effects like nausea and stomach upset are possible, typically resolving spontaneously. However, persistent or bothersome symptoms warrant medical consultation. Diarrhea, another potential side effect, usually subsides upon treatment completion; report persistent diarrhea or blood in stool immediately. Prior allergies to any component necessitate avoidance. Seek immediate medical help for rare, serious allergic reactions manifested by rash, facial or tongue swelling, breathlessness, or respiratory distress. Disclose any kidney problems to your doctor before starting treatment.

How to use Oxo 400mg Tablet:

Follow your doctor's instructions precisely regarding the dosage and treatment length for this medication. The tablet should be swallowed whole; avoid crushing, chewing, or breaking it. Oxo 400mg Tablets can be ingested with or without food, though consistent timing is recommended.

How Oxo 400mg Tablet works:

The antibiotic Oxo 400mg Tablet functions by inhibiting the bacterial enzyme DNA-gyrase. This inhibition blocks bacterial cell division and repair, resulting in bacterial death.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Consuming alcohol alongside Oxo 400mg Tablets is inadvisable.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Oxo 400mg tablets during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scant, animal studies indicate potential harm to the unborn child. A physician will assess the potential benefits against these risks pr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Oxo 400mg tablets while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Preliminary data from human studies indicate potential transfer of the medication into breast milk, posing a possible ris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Taking a 400mg Oxo tablet can cause drowsiness, blurred vision, and dizziness, potentially impairing alertness. Driving should be avoided if these effects are experienced.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Patients with kidney impairment should exercise caution when using Oxo 400mg tablets. Dosage modification may be necessary; physician consultation is advised.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Patients with liver impairment should exercise caution when using Oxo 400mg tablets. Dosage modification may be necessary. A physician's consultation is advised.

What if you forget to take Oxo 400mg Tablet :

Should you forget to take your Oxo 400mg Tablet, administer it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Oxo 400mg Tablet

Oxo 400mg Tablets can cause diarrhea as a side effect. This is because, while the antibiotic targets harmful bacteria, it can also disrupt beneficial gut bacteria, leading to diarrhea. Consult your doctor if you experience severe diarrhea.
Continue taking your Oxo 400mg Tablet as prescribed, completing the entire course even if you feel better. Full recovery requires finishing the medication, despite symptom improvement.
Oxo 400mg tablets can increase the risk of muscle damage, particularly in the Achilles tendon. This risk applies to all age groups. Report any muscle pain to your doctor while taking this medication.
